JPMorgan Snags Top Talent in Tech M&A with Bank of America Hire
JPMorgan Chase has hired David Fishman, a veteran technology dealmaker from Bank of America, to lead its North America technology mergers and acquisitions practice. Fishman will join JPMorgan later this year as head of North America technology M&A.
The move is part of a broader restructuring of JPMorgan's technology banking leadership, which includes the formation of a Technology M&A Leadership and Advisory Council to serve key clients in the sector. Fishman and Vineet Seth, who currently leads North America technology M&A, will sit on the new council.
Fishman most recently served as co-head of technology, media and telecommunications investment banking at Bank of America, where he spent nearly 16 years. He resigned earlier this week to join JPMorgan.
